Career Path

In the ever-evolving global landscape, a Professional Certificate in Intercultural Media and Global Affairs can equip you with the necessary skills to navigate a wide range of careers. Let's take a closer look at these promising roles in a 3D pie chart, which highlights their respective market shares. 1. **International Relations Specialist** (25%): These professionals serve as liaisons between organizations, governments, and non-governmental entities, promoting cooperation and understanding on a global scale. 2. **Global Communications Expert** (20%): In this role, you'll develop and implement strategic communication plans for international organizations, ensuring effective cross-cultural messaging and public relations. 3. **Cultural Analyst** (18%): Cultural analysts study and interpret global trends, social norms, and cultural nuances, providing valuable insights to help businesses and organizations adapt and thrive in diverse markets. 4. **Intercultural Media Strategist** (15%): As a media strategist, you'll create and manage multimedia campaigns targeting various cultural markets, leveraging your understanding of global media channels and audience preferences. 5. **Global Affairs Consultant** (12%): Consultants advise governments, corporations, and non-profits on global issues, risks, and opportunities, often specializing in areas like trade, security, or diplomacy. 6. **Diplomacy Advisor** (10%): Diplomacy advisors provide guidance to diplomats, embassies, and foreign ministries, assisting in the development of foreign policies and fostering positive relationships among nations.
